## Approvals — Public API Pagination

All changes to cursor encoding, page-size limits, or the deprecation of offset parameters in the Mistral-Gate public REST API require security review plus owner approval before release. Cursor contents must remain opaque and signed. No exceptions for hotfixes. Final approval authority for pagination changes rests with one person.

named custodian: Oliath Ralax

## Limits & Quotas: PicShelf image cache leak

Heads up for the release manager: the PicShelf thumbnail cache in 4.2 doesn't evict decoded bitmaps, so memory climbs roughly 40 MB per hour under normal browsing. We've capped the cache hard as a stopgap until the proper fix lands in 4.3. Don't ship a build that raises these limits — it'll OOM low-end devices within a day. Here are the caps we're shipping with.

constants for fajep-kawig:
QUOTAS = {
    "belath": 89,
    "tamdor": 722,
}

Subject: Export retry fix shipped

Team — Fernwick export jobs that failed on transient storage errors now retry with backoff instead of dying silently. Three attempts, then dead-letter. Backfill for last week's stuck exports runs tonight. No schema changes, no config flags. Dashboards updated; watch the retry-count panel through Thursday. Rollback is a one-line revert if needed. Build for verification follows.

session token of kageg-tahop = htk14_af3c1ccccb7dcf

Management Meeting Minutes — Hollis & Brede Manufacturing

Attendees: dept heads, ops lead Sørna Vant.

1. Training budget FY next: capped at 4% of payroll. No increase.
2. External courses require pre-approval; internal-first policy stands.
3. Certification renewals protected; conference travel cut 50%.
4. Dept heads submit plans by month-end.
5. Unspent funds do not roll over.

Rationale tied to wider planning; see the note below.

confidential, kagep-kahof: Druokax Systems plans to lower the Ulaath list price by 53 percent in March.